Cost of Living Calculator - Hoover, Alabama vs Southern Pines, North Carolina


The cost of living in Southern Pines, North Carolina is 5.6% cheaper than Hoover, Alabama.

You would need a salary of $70,822 in Southern Pines, North Carolina to maintain the standard of living you have in Hoover, Alabama.
